More people are choosing resin garden furniture across the UK due to its sturdiness, low care requirements, and ability to withstand the elements. Whether you're furnishing a compact patio or a spacious garden area, resin presents a trustworthy and practical alternative to metal or wood.
Unlike wood that may rot or metal subject to rust, resin does not absorb water, retains its shape, and continues looking good with little attention. Its maintenance simplicity makes it perfect for communal gardens.
Benefits of Resin Garden Sets
Designed for the UK's changeable weather, resin doesn’t hold moisture, and holds its tone even with long periods in the sun. This ensures longevity. Compared to metal furnishings, resin is lightweight, making it more flexible when needed.
Cleaning is simple: soapy water and a sponge usually tackles bird droppings. There’s no need for sanding or painting, keeping expenses minimal.

How to Look After Resin Garden Furniture
In summer, a quick rinse usually keeps it looking fresh. For persistent marks, apply soapy water and sponge gently. To protect cushions, bring them inside when not in use.
Do not put hot items directly on resin, as heat can cause warping.
